Netgear AX1800 RAX20

Netgear AX1800 RAX20 review

Recently purchased from Amazon.co.uk

The Netgear RAX20 is a WiFi 6 device. Supports Wireless 2.4GHz b/g/n/ax and 5GHz a/n/ac/ax. So far this router has proved to be very capable and has cured the problems I had using Virgin Media HUB3. It caters for most of the requirements of a typical home. We are heavy networking users with 2 people working from home, forever watching NETFLIX in 4K and football matches via SKY and BT Sports. So far no issues but early days.

2 August 2020

Happy to report all home has better WiFi coverage and much more stable. Best of all the dreaded Virgin Media hub has been relegated to modem mode. The frequent reboots of the VM router are no longer required, thankfully.

Also a minor issue with Access Control has been fixed with a firmware update.

Improved Network Capacity for More WiFi Devices. Orthogonal Frequency-Division Multiple Access (OFDMA) enables efficient data scheduling so that more transmissions can be sent at the same time, resulting in an impressive capacity increase in your network. This increased or available bandwidth allows you to add more devices to your network. The AX1800 WiFi 6 Router supports uplink and downlink OFDMA to efficiently use air-time with better frequency reuse, reduced latency, and increased network efficiency. This is extremely useful for latency sensitive applications such as virtual reality (VR), augmented reality (AR) and Internet of things (IoT) sensors
